Facts about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her

✔️

Who wrote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her lyrics?


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her is written by Dean Dillon.
✔️

When was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her released?


It is first released in 1986 as part of George Strait's album "#7" which includes 10 tracks in total. This song is the 1st track on this album.
✔️

Which genre is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her?


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her falls under the genre Urban Cowboy.
✔️

How long is the song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her?


Nobody In His Right Mind Would've Left Her song length is 2 minutes and 52 seconds.
